Transaction 8995bc79c713a6705fb92ccb697fbc4ebb3ede6ed27f0d92de91e11075dc2b6d
1 Input
2 Outputs
- 8995bc79c713a6705fb92ccb697fbc4ebb3ede6ed27f0d92de91e11075dc2b6d:0
- 8995bc79c713a6705fb92ccb697fbc4ebb3ede6ed27f0d92de91e11075dc2b6d:1
value 3445882
address 3Dpzuj7svHiac9SnWoJMFSqKn8Rz9mQ77Z
value 9957207
address 1LZEF3J8YzBYFfugeNwVsYWA1PxCPaR3Rz